The pay range for this role is £74,454 – £89,081 (pro rata for part‑time colleagues). Two positions are available:
Town Clerk and Responsible Finance Officer (RFO).
We are looking to appoint two highly motivated and forward‑thinking Town Clerks and RFOs to help build and shape the governance, culture and delivery of high‑quality local services for Bournemouth Town Council and Poole Town Council, which will be established on 1 April 2026 following a community governance review.
